Zlatan Ibrahimovic met Pope Francis yesterday and gifted him his latest book and a Milan shirt.

The Swede met Pope Francis at the Vatican on Tuesday evening, posting a picture on his social media accounts.

According to La Gazzetta dello Sport, Ibra gifted the Pope a copy of his latest book, called ‘Adrenaline’ and a Milan jersey.

“I’ve brought something that I wanted to give you in person,” Ibrahimovic said.

“That’s a part of my history and contains the description of my life and a little message for you.”

When the 40-year-old gave his Milan shirt to the Holy Father, he said: “Do you like Milan? I usually do magic with this on the pitch.”

Pope Francis thanked Ibra and gifted the striker his own book, ‘Sport according to Pope Francis.’
